What Is Fibrin?

Fibrin is an insoluble protein formed from fibrinogen, a protein produced by the liver and circulated in the bloodstream.

When a blood vessel becomes damaged, the body activates a sophisticated clotting cascade:

  1. Platelets gather at the injury.
  2. Thrombin converts fibrinogen into fibrin.
  3. Fibrin strands weave together like a net.
  4. The net traps blood cells and platelets to form a stable clot.

This process is essential for healing.

Once healing is complete, another natural system called fibrinolysis gradually breaks down the fibrin so normal blood flow can resume.

The Body's Natural Fibrin Removal System

Your body continuously regulates fibrin through a process known as fibrinolysis.

The primary enzyme responsible is plasmin, which gradually dissolves fibrin once healing has occurred.

Unfortunately, natural fibrinolytic activity tends to decline with age.

This has led researchers to investigate natural enzymes that may help support the body's normal fibrin-clearing mechanisms.

Nattokinase: The Best-Known Natural Fibrin-Supporting Enzyme

Nattokinase is produced during the fermentation of the traditional Japanese food natto.

It has become one of the world's most researched systemic enzymes for supporting healthy circulation.

Lumbrokinase: A Highly Targeted Systemic Enzyme

Lumbrokinase consists of a group of naturally occurring enzymes originally isolated from earthworms.

Research suggests these enzymes have a strong affinity for fibrin and may support the body's natural fibrinolytic processes.

Compared with many other enzymes, lumbrokinase appears to be highly selective toward fibrin.
